C语言:温度转换(c语言温度转换保留两位小数)
本篇目录:
C语言已知华氏温度F,转换为摄氏温度
摄氏温度(℃)和华氏温度(℉)之间的换算关系为: 华氏度=摄氏度×8+32 摄氏度=(华氏度-32)÷8 5(华氏度-50)=9(摄氏度-10)。
c语言输入一个华氏温度,输出摄氏温度公式为c=5/9(f-32)。
用C语言打印输出华氏温度转摄氏温度的几种方法 利用公式℃=(5/9)*(℉-32)以vc++0为例。
下面是将华氏温度F=100转换为摄氏温度C的C语言代码示例,其中包含注释以帮助理解:输出结果为:vbnet100.00 degrees Fahrenheit is equal to 378 degrees Celsius.解释:第1行:包含stdio.h头文件,以便使用printf函数。
您好,很高兴回答您的问题。华氏度与摄氏度的转化是摄氏度=(华氏度-32)*5/9。用c语言来表示时,一定要注意华氏度和摄氏度都定义为实型。因为c语言规定,整型数据间进行运算,结果只能为整型,就会影响最后的结果。
C语言程序温度的转换
第9行:使用转换公式将华氏温度转换为摄氏温度,并将结果存储在变量c中。第12行:使用printf函数输出结果,其中%.2f表示输出浮点数并保留两位小数,第一个%f输出f的值,第二个%f输出c的值。第14行:返回0表示程序执行成功。
通过程序来计算式子:(a + b)*c/(d*d - e*e*e)。
摄氏温标(°C)和华氏温标(°F)之间的换算关系为:F=C×8+32。C=(F-32)÷8。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。
用C语言打印输出华氏温度转摄氏温度的几种方法 利用公式℃=(5/9)*(℉-32)以vc++0为例。
题目:编写该程序,计算华氏温度一百五十对应的摄氏温度。计算公式:c=5(f-31)/9,输出数据要求为整型。c为摄氏度,f为华氏温度。
c语言编程怎么设计温度转换?
第9行:使用转换公式将华氏温度转换为摄氏温度,并将结果存储在变量c中。第12行:使用printf函数输出结果,其中%.2f表示输出浮点数并保留两位小数,第一个%f输出f的值,第二个%f输出c的值。第14行:返回0表示程序执行成功。
int z;printf(请选择:\n);printf( (1)将温度从摄氏度转换为华氏度。
摄氏温标(°C)和华氏温标(°F)之间的换算关系为:F=C×8+32。C=(F-32)÷8。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。
注意:若F为华氏温度,C为摄氏温度,则转换公式为C=5/9 (F32),输出结果取2位小数。特别注意公式转换为C语言表达式时的正确性。
第一段代码,首先计算5/9这个值你可以试一试,在c语言中他的值为0,然后0*后面的自然是0.第二个由于你写的是0/0所以可以往后精确,算出来的数就不会是0,*后面的式子也就不会得0 .。。
C语言:编写摄氏温度、华氏温度转换程序,怎么写?
1、下面是将华氏温度F=100转换为摄氏温度C的C语言代码示例,其中包含注释以帮助理解:输出结果为:vbnet100.00 degrees Fahrenheit is equal to 378 degrees Celsius.解释:第1行:包含stdio.h头文件,以便使用printf函数。
2、includestdio.hmain(){double C;while(1){scanf(%lf,&C);printf(F = %lf\n,(C+32)*9/5);}}如图所示,望采纳。。
3、首先,你定义的变量celsius是一个整形变量,当程序运行到celsius=0*fahr/0-30/0*0;这里时,会自动把右边的表达式值变成一个整形的,然后赋值给celsius。在把这个值变成整形的时候会把小数部分舍去。
4、摄氏温标(°C)和华氏温标(°F)之间的换算关系为:F=C×8+32。C=(F-32)÷8。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。
c语言摄氏度与华氏温度如何转换?
您好,很高兴回答您的问题。华氏度与摄氏度的转化是摄氏度=(华氏度-32)*5/9。用c语言来表示时,一定要注意华氏度和摄氏度都定义为实型。因为c语言规定,整型数据间进行运算,结果只能为整型,就会影响最后的结果。
摄氏温标(°C)和华氏温标(°F)之间的换算关系为:F=C×8+32。C=(F-32)÷8。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。
因为你定义的变量是float类型,而如果输入5和9的话,电脑会认为是两个整形数据先相除,然后再转换成float型,所以就变成0了。
include main(){ float x,y;int z;printf(请选择:\n);printf((1)将温度从摄氏度转换为华氏度。
到此,以上就是小编对于c语言温度转换保留两位小数的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。